Performance of the Japanese indices
At the end of the day, the Nikkei index registered an increase of 0.3% to 39,395.60 points. The Topix index also closed in positive territory, with a slight increase of 0.1%, reaching 2,742.24 points. The growing sectors
Among the sectors that have shown the best performance, those related to high-tech stand out. In particular, chip testing equipment manufacturer, Advantest, saw an increase of 3.4%. The Fujikura stock, a well-known manufacturer of electronic components, also registered an increase of 3.1%.
